Fixed income investments, within the context of cryptocurrency and derivatives, represent strategies aiming to generate predictable cash flows, often mirroring traditional bond markets through tokenized debt or synthetic exposures. These instruments seek to mitigate the inherent volatility of digital assets by providing a stream of returns less correlated with directional price movements. The application of quantitative methods, such as yield curve construction using decentralized finance (DeFi) protocols, allows for the creation of structured products offering defined income profiles. Consequently, these assets function as portfolio diversifiers, reducing overall risk-adjusted returns in a dynamic market environment.
Calculation
Yield calculations in crypto fixed income differ significantly from traditional finance, incorporating factors like staking rewards, liquidity mining incentives, and protocol-specific risk parameters. Determining an accurate yield necessitates modeling impermanent loss, smart contract vulnerabilities, and the potential for protocol governance changes. Sophisticated models employ Monte Carlo simulations to project future cash flows, accounting for the non-linear nature of DeFi yields and the impact of network congestion on transaction costs. Precise calculation of risk-adjusted returns is crucial for evaluating the true economic value of these investments.
Risk
Assessing risk within crypto fixed income requires a nuanced understanding of smart contract audit reports, collateralization ratios, and the potential for systemic failures within DeFi ecosystems. Counterparty risk is paramount, as the solvency of underlying protocols directly impacts the ability to fulfill promised payments. Furthermore, regulatory uncertainty and the evolving legal landscape introduce additional layers of complexity, demanding continuous monitoring and adaptation of risk management frameworks.
